COMMAND LINE FUNCTIONS

There are a number of command line functions that enables the user to obtain running information of a
single OSD2251EP unit or the complete topology of the ring/bus network. This section explains the
command lines and its functions.
When the terminal emulation program is operating, connect the USB cable to any one of the
OSD2251EP units on the ring/bus network – or alternatively, the OSD2251EP unit which the user
wishes to interrogate. Note: A message will be displayed on the terminal emulation program when the
unit is powered after USB connection. This message will not open when the unit is switched on while
plugging in the USB cable, however the command lines are functional.
The following table outlines the user available command line commands and their functions
